You ought to constantly make use of two pails when washing a vehicle, and never ever just one. The very first need to be loaded with sudsy car hair shampoo, the other with securely sourced water for rinsing. Your unclean wash glove or microfiber cloth need to always enter the pure H20 container before being dipped in the soapy remedy to get lower cross-contamination.

Washing matte-painted surfaces requires special attention and should be done more frequently. The key difference in between level and matte paint is that flat paint does not have any sparkle, whereas matte paint might have a slight sheen.


The matte paint layer is appropriate for automobile as it supplies a slightly shiny appearance and is a lot more resilient than level paint. On the other hand, if you desire an absolutely non-reflective coating, flat paint is your best choice.
